Reverse Factoring Advantages for Buyers and Suppliers
The reverse factoring advantages extend beyond improving cash flow, offering benefits to both buyers and suppliers. Reverse factoring advantages include reduced financing costs for suppliers, improved liquidity, and strengthened buyer-supplier relationships. Buyers gain the flexibility to extend payment terms without disrupting their vendors, enhancing supply chain efficiency.
Understanding Reverse Factoring Disadvantages
While beneficial, there are reverse factoring disadvantages to consider when implementing this financial strategy. Reverse factoring disadvantages may include complexities in setting up agreements and the need for alignment between buyers, suppliers, and financial institutions. Additionally, suppliers who rely too heavily on reverse factoring may face challenges if the buyer alters terms or cancels the arrangement.
